python-sdk: show persisted turn items in example 02 (2026-03-13)
Update the sync and async turn-run examples to read the thread after a completed turn and print the persisted item count instead of the empty immediate TurnResult.items list. This makes the example output match the current app-server behavior, where the completed turn payload can have empty items even though the persisted thread turn later contains the generated items.
